An Italian court has ensured that her employer will pay her sick leave for the time that she cared for her sick dog.

A female academic from the University La Sapienza in Rome, won the case with the help of lawyers from the Italian League against vivisection in Italy (LAV).

This is the first such case in the history of the proceedings in Italy. The judge ruled that the University must treat the absence of women at work as «no good reason or family circumstances».

The plaintiff, whose name is not called, asked for leave for two days to care for your dog, 12-year-old English setter named Luciola, which at that time had just been through a surgical operation.

The women lawyers at the hearing pointed to the fact that under Italian law, people who abandon animals, thereby exposing them to the «severe suffering», faces a prison sentence of 1 year and a fine amounting to 10 000 euros (11 865$).

The head of the LAV, Gianluca Felicetti, stated that this court’s precedent represents a significant step forward. Having decided in favor of the plaintiff, the court recognized that animalsthat are not used for financial gain or for work, are family members. Now people who are in a similar situation, will be able to use this case as an example to solve their own problems with the authorities.
